Grace Blair went to be with the lord on Thursday, March 24, 2022, at her home, surrounded by loved ones. Grace was born to parents, Horace and Pearl Rogers in West Virginia. Grace resided in Blountville, Tennessee and was a proud member of New Grace Baptist Church of Bristol, TN. Undoubtedly a hard-working and driven woman, Grace worked for many years at Sears before ultimately retiring from the company. Grace was also co-owner of Central Buses Incorporated. She was blessed with a large family whom she loved dearly, especially her several grandchildren and great-grandchildren.
